520 | _a"Cultural Heritage and the Future brings together an international group of scholars and experts to consider the relationship between cultural heritage and the future. Drawing on case studies from around the world, the contributing authors insist that cultural heritage and the future are deeply and inherently linked. Chapters within the volume also argue that the development of future-thinking should be a priority for academics, students and those working in the wider professional heritage sector. The future has never before attracted substantial research and debate within heritage studies and heritage management, and this book addresses this lacuna by offering a balance of theoretical and empirical content that will stimulate multidisciplinary debate in the burgeoning field of critical heritage studies. Cultural Heritage and the Future questions how we can communicate with future generations through heritage and will be of great interest to academics and students working in the fields of museum and heritage studies, archaeology, anthropology, sociology, history and geography. Those working in the heritage professions will also find much to interest them within the pages of this book"-- | ||
